Mount Kimbie announce new album
By Andy Malt | Published on Thursday 13 July 2017
Mount Kimbie have announced that they will release their third album, titled ‘Love What Survives’, on 8 Sep.
Of making the record, the duo say: “It’s been a fascinating process that has changed us as a band and we’re feeling great about how it’s come together”.
The album features several collaborations, including two with long-time collaborator James Blake, one of which was released earlier this year. New single ‘Blue Train Lines’ sees them teaming up for a second time with King Krule – who worked with the duo on ‘You Took Your Time’ from their second album, ‘Cold Spring Fault Less Youth’.
